2860 Products

All items

2860 Products

Face Oil
Face Oil
Face Oil
Herbar

Face Oil

$353.00

Variants
  • 50ml
  • 15ml
Carin Skirt
Carin Skirt
Carin Skirt
Carven

Carin Skirt

$1,096.00 $2,740.00 (60% Off.)

Variants
  • 34
  • 36
  • 38